Lessons from Dash the Dog…


Meet Dash, a loving, fun and happy Papillon and Pomeranian mix.  We are happily dog sitting for one of our dear friends who is celebrating a long weekend away.  You would never know that only a few months ago Dash was attacked by a bigger dog during one of his regular walks.  He was bit on the neck and had a tube sticking out of his neck for weeks to help drain his wound.  Knowing Dash’s history I wanted my home to be comforting and calm.  My dog who has not had any traumatic issues just ignored happy go lucky Dash.

Dash was warm, friendly, loving and trusting.  I was in awe of how he was so loving and sweet.  He even met my parents dog who is a much bigger German Shepard.  Dash was just curious and cautious but very open and willing to meet him.   Thank you Dash for teaching me that no matter how hurt and bruised we can get with life it’s okay to trust again.  It’s okay to trust that we can be happy again, to trust that we can be playful again and trust that we don’t always need to be afraid of being hurt again.  If we choose to live in fear then we may miss out on making new friends, finding new love and just miss out on having a happy life.

Thank you Dash!!
